
Przedstawiamy Zero Install: zdecentralizowane rozwiązanie do instalacji oprogramowania
Zero Install to innowacyjny, zdecentralizowany system instalacji oprogramowania zaprojektowany do pracy na wielu platformach. Licencjonowane na podstawie LGPL narzędzie to umożliwia deweloperom publikowanie aplikacji bezpośrednio z ich własnych witryn. Dzięki temu wprowadza znane funkcje, które są zazwyczaj kojarzone ze scentralizowanymi systemami dystrybucji oprogramowania, takie jak biblioteki współdzielone, automatyczne aktualizacje i podpisy cyfrowe.
Ten elastyczny system został zaprojektowany, aby udoskonalić, a nie zastąpić, istniejące systemy zarządzania pakietami w systemach operacyjnych. Co ciekawe, pakiety 0install unikają konfliktów z pakietami oferowanymi przez dystrybucję użytkownika, zapewniając płynne współistnienie.
Unikalne cechy instalacji zerowej
Zero Install wyróżnia się spośród tradycyjnych menedżerów pakietów kilkoma godnymi uwagi funkcjonalnościami. Podczas gdy promuje współdzielenie bibliotek w najszerszym zakresie, ma również możliwość jednoczesnej instalacji wielu wersji pakietu, dostosowując się do różnych wymagań pakietów. Ponadto instalacje są całkowicie wolne od efektów ubocznych; każdy pakiet jest rozpakowywany do dedykowanego katalogu, co oznacza, że nie wpływa na katalogi współdzielone. Ta cecha sprawia, że jest on szczególnie odpowiedni dla programistów wykorzystujących technologie sandboxingu i środowiska wirtualne.
Dodatkową zaletą jest to, że plik XML, który opisuje zależności aplikacji, można zintegrować bezpośrednio z repozytorium kodu źródłowego. Ta funkcja zapewnia kompleksowe zarządzanie zależnościami dla wersji deweloperskich, które nie zostały jeszcze wydane. Na przykład deweloperzy mogą klonować repozytorium Git, budować i testować aplikacje, wykorzystując najnowsze biblioteki, a wszystko to bez kolizji z wersjami bibliotek zainstalowanymi przez dystrybucję ich systemu operacyjnego.
Aktualizacje Zero Install Wersja 2.26.3
Najnowsza wersja Zero Install 2.26.3 wprowadza kilka ważnych udoskonaleń:
- Ulepszona obsługa nieprawidłowych manifestów podczas samodzielnego wdrażania
- Pliki AppleDouble są teraz wykluczone z manifestów
- Naprawiono problemy związane z nieobsługiwanymi wyjątkami ConfigurationErrorsExceptions
- Rozwiązano problem nadmiarowych prób dostępu do plików i rejestru
- Zaktualizowano zależność od SharpCompress do wersji 0.39.0
- Ulepszone tłumaczenia zapewniające szerszą dostępność
Rozpocznij od instalacji zerowej
Najnowszą wersję Zero Install możesz pobrać tutaj: Zero Install 2.26.3 (4, 2 MB) – rozwiązanie typu open source gotowe zarówno dla programistów, jak i użytkowników.
Aby uzyskać więcej informacji, odwiedź oficjalną stronę Zero Install, zapoznaj się z jej funkcjami lub sprawdź dostępne aplikacje.

Dodaj komentarz